Return elections of local government chairmen to INEC – Senator Barau to Tinubu

The Deputy Senate President, Senator Barau Jibrin, has urged President Ahmad Bola Tinubu to take the lead in strengthening Nigeria’s Local Government areas.

Senator Barau Jibrin also recommended transferring the responsibility for Local Government Chairmen elections to the Independent Electoral Commission (INEC) to empower these leaders with execution and decision-making authority.

Responding to a motion on restoring local government powers, Senator Jibrin noted that the issues arise because state governors exert control over Local Councils through various methods.

He said, “We observed that when INEC conducted Local Government elections, the councils were more vibrant, with even Councillors awarding contracts, and operations were smoother.”

”Currently, Local Government Chairmen operate at the discretion of state governors, who control their elections and finances.”

“We are dissatisfied with the current situation, and I believe no one is happy with it. Therefore, it is our collective responsibility to advocate for the restoration of local governments in Nigeria.”

”We need dynamic Councils that can enhance the economic well-being of the grassroots.”

“I believe everyone is concerned about the current state of affairs, and that is why I urge Mr. President, a true Democrat who upholds democratic norms and culture, to lead the effort in restoring local government powers in the country.”
